M. Majoros et al., Apparent ac losses in helical BiPbSrCaCuO-2223/Ag multifilamentary tape measured by different potential taps at power frequencies, PHYSICA C, 314(1-2), 1999, pp. 1-11
Transport ac losses in BiPbSrCaCuO-2223/Ag multifilamentary tape in form of
a helix with a 3 mm gap between the turns were measured in frequency range
40-125 Hz. Different positions of potential taps on outer and inner surfac
e of the tape were used. Potential wires were led along the tape axis as we
ll as along the axis of the helix. At currents lower than the critical curr
ent a strong dependence of measured apparent ac losses on potential taps po
sition and on the form of potential wires was found, Suitably wound contact
-less pick-up coils to detect magnetic flux of different magnetic field com
ponents were also used. They allowed us to measure the 'magnetisation' part
of apparent losses even when the sample was in resistive state, as well as
the losses at the gap of the tape. Comparison of the losses at the gap of
the tape with the existing theoretical model was made. (C) 1999 Published b
y Elsevier Science B.V. All rights reserved.
